The Phoenix Contact RJ45 PCB Connector is engineered for demanding applications requiring robust performance in challenging environments. Its superior design guarantees reliable data transmission at speeds of up to 10 Gbps, making it an ideal choice for high-performance networking tasks. This connector features a degree of protection rated at IP20, ensuring durability and resistance to environmental factors. The innovative 360° shielding effectively mitigates electromagnetic interference, while the incorporation of hybrid LEDs provides visual status indicators for data transfer. Built to endure extreme conditions, it operates seamlessly in temperatures ranging from -40°C to 105°C. Whether in industrial automation or telecommunications infrastructures, the RJ45 PCB connector stands out with its advanced specifications and reliable functionality.

Optimised for high shock and vibration resistance

Integrated hybrid LEDs act as optical indicators for transmission status

Designed for ease of automated handling due to its reflow capability

Constructed with superior shielding for enhanced signal integrity

Accommodates various mounting types ensuring versatility

Cleaning friendly surface due to its housing material

Solder cycles allow for convenient reflow processing
